How Products Are Made

Producing goods and products is a complex process that involves several steps and techniques. From the conception of an idea or design to the final product, each stage requires careful planning, precision, and expertise. In this article, we will explore How Products Are Made, focusing on both traditional and modern manufacturing methods, and the factors that influence the production processes.

The manufacturing process begins with an idea or a need for a certain product. This could be for everyday items such as clothes, furniture, or electronics, or even for specialized products like aerospace components or medical devices. Once the concept is established, designers and engineers work together to create detailed plans and specifications for the product.

The next step involves selecting the materials that will be used in the production process. These materials could be metals, plastics, fabrics, or a combination of different substances. The choice of materials depends on factors such as functionality, durability, cost, and availability. For example, if the product needs to withstand high temperatures or corrosion, metals like titanium or stainless steel may be selected.

Once the materials are finalized, the manufacturing process can begin. Traditional methods, such as casting and molding, have been used for centuries and are still employed today. Casting involves pouring molten metal or other materials into a mold, allowing it to cool and solidify in the desired shape. Molding, on the other hand, uses a mold to shape materials such as plastic or rubber.

In recent years, advancements in technology have revolutionized the manufacturing industry. Computer-aided design (CAD) and computer-aided manufacturing (CAM) have made it possible to create complex designs and prototypes with precision. 3D printing, also known as additive manufacturing, has gained popularity as it allows for the creation of three-dimensional objects layer by layer, using materials such as plastic, metal, or even concrete.

After the initial manufacturing processes, the products might undergo various additional treatments or assembly stages. Surface finishing techniques like sanding, polishing, or painting are used to enhance the appearance and protect the product. Assembly lines or robotic systems are utilized to join different components together, ensuring a high level of accuracy and efficiency.

Quality control plays a crucial role in the manufacturing process. Inspections and tests are conducted at various stages to identify any defects or deviations from the desired specifications. This helps ensure that the final product meets the required standards and is safe for consumer use.

Furthermore, sustainability and environmental considerations are becoming increasingly important in the manufacturing industry. The use of eco-friendly materials, energy-efficient machinery, and waste reduction strategies are being adopted to minimize the impact on the environment. Recycling and reusing materials are also common practices to reduce waste and conserve resources.

In addition to the physical manufacturing process, logistics and distribution play a key role in getting the finished products to consumers. Supply chain management, including transportation, storage, and inventory management, ensures that products are delivered efficiently and on time.

In conclusion, the process of How Products Are Made involves several steps and factors. From the initial idea to the final distribution, manufacturers meticulously plan, design, and produce goods using various techniques and technologies. It is a dynamic and evolving field that continues to embrace advancements in materials, machinery, and practices to meet the demands of consumers and the ever-changing market.
